RuleStream Corporation

RuleStream is a privately held corporation founded in 1999 by leading experts of the Knowledge-based Engineering industry—an industry that did the right thing in the wrong way for almost 20 years. RuleStream has invented a patent-pending technology to turn a service business into an off-the-shelf enterprise software product business. The product, the RuleStream® system, captures product related rules to automate key business processes, thus delivering an unbeatable competitive advantage to every manufacturer that chooses to use it. The company is headquartered in Boston, has a technical center in Cleveland, and has established field operations in North America through offices in Boston, Cleveland, Detroit, Dallas, San Jose, Washington D.C., and Seattle. It is funded by Masthead Venture Partners.


Today, engineer-to-order (ETO) manufacturers—also known as project-based manufacturers—experience significant market pressure across their sales, engineering and manufacturing groups as they strive to win business and streamline end-to-end processes. But by capturing engineering knowledge and using it to automate key business processes, manufacturers can increase sales bid and win rates, decrease internal operating expenses, and shorten lead times.
